Compensation helps man get his life back

news image Thanks to a compensation payout, a motorcycle-lover is back on his bike despite a crash which left him paralysed from the waist down.

Despite suffering a severed spinal cord following a collision in July 2005, Vytautus Gerdziunas, 54, from West Yorkshire, is King of the Road again after suing the car owner for driving without due car and attention, the Yorkshire Evening Post reports.

Mr Gerdziunas told the news source: "At one point the vision of the future was pretty grim […] I thought the prospect of making life anything like it was before the accident was pure fantasy.

"Initially I didn't fancy the idea of buying a trike but […] I went for a test ride and came back with a huge smile on my face and I have not looked back since."

The compensation payout, in the form of a lump sum and an index-linked yearly supplement, also helped Mr Gerdziunas pay for a move to a specially-equipped bungalow from his two-storey terrace.

Motorbike riders are particularly at risk of injury if involved in a collision, and can make a case for compensation if a driver can be proved responsible for the crash.
